Details of IFSC Code for Icici Bank Limited, Kohima, Kohima

Here are the key points that are associated with the IFSC Code ICIC0000961 of Icici Bank Limited for its branch located in Kohima, within the district of Kohima in the state of Nagaland.

Particulars Details
Bank Icici Bank Limited
IFSC Code ICIC0000961
Branch Kohima
City Kohima
District Kohima
State Nagaland
Address Icici Bank Ltd., D Block, Kohima Nagaland.797001

What Is IFSC Code and Why Is It Important?

IFSC stands for Indian Financial System Code, an 11-character alphanumeric code provided by the Reserve Bank of India. Every bank branch, along with Icici Bank Limited located in Kohima, Kohima, Nagaland, are given a unique IFSC like ICIC0000961 to ensure that online payments reach the right destination.

Format of the IFSC Code ICIC0000961

The format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Icici Bank Limited, follows an 11-character structure:

AAAA0CCCCCC

Here's the breakdown of this:

  • First 4 characters (AAAA): Represent the bank code. For Icici Bank Limited, these characters are the bank's short identifier.
  • 5th character (0): Always zero which is reserved for future use.
  •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): Represent the specific branch code assigned to branches such as Kohima in Kohima.

How to Use IFSC Code ICIC0000961 for Online Transfers?

Once you have the IFSC Code ICIC0000961 for the Kohima branch of Icici Bank Limited in Kohima, you can start with your fund transfers using any digital method:

NEFT

Add beneficiary details including the name, account number, and IFSC Code ICIC0000961. Transfers are processed in batches. Suitable for personal and business payments.

RTGS

Used for payments above 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.

IMPS

Instant 24×7 transfers. You need the recipient's account details and Icici Bank Limited IFSC Code ICIC0000961.

Whatever method you choose, the accuracy of the IFSC Code is highly important. If there is any mistake in entering the IFSC Code for Icici Bank Limited Kohima in Kohima, it can result in delayed or failed transactions.
